takeaways

noun

  1. 1

    A restaurant that sells food to be eaten elsewhere.

    If you're hungry, there's a takeaway just around the corner.
  2. 2

    A meal bought to be eaten elsewhere.

    I fancy an Indian takeaway tonight.
  3. 3

    The preliminary part of a golfer′s swing when the club is brought back away from the ball.

  4. 4

    A concession made by a labor union in the course of negotiations.

  5. 5

    (frequently plural) An idea from a talk, presentation, etc., that the listener or reader should remember and consider.
